## Crashfunnel Environments

Crashfunnel ingests crash reports from the Lumora mobile apps. Three environments: dev, staging, prod. Dev drops payloads after 24h. Staging mirrors prod schema but samples at 10%. Prod retains 90 days.

On-call: if ingestion stalls, check the symbolication queue first — it backs up before anything else. Restarts are safe; the pipeline is idempotent. Never replay prod payloads into staging.

The current prod configuration values are listed below.

deployment values, tafof-taduf:
pelius:
  pin: 6508
  tenant: praiel
  seal: seal_4e33a2f4
  metrics_host: metrics.pelius.plorvagrid.corp
  standby_team: druix
  escalation: juldor-norius
  nonce: 5db598

Handover note — Crumbwheel order cutoffs.

Welcome aboard. The bakery cutoff rule in Crumbwheel closes same-day orders at 14:00 local to each storefront, not UTC — this has bitten us twice. Holiday overrides live in the calendar service and take precedence silently, so always check there first when a cutoff looks wrong. To unlock the calendar service's admin console after a restart, enter the recovery passphrase below.

vault phrase of bagap-bahaf = silion-pelox-sorox-casdor-quenwyn-fraax-eliox-praael-kelion-quenvan-kasox-rusael-norius-belvan

## Fan-out release: Stormline alerts

Reviewer notes: this release changes how Stormline fans out weather alerts to regional queues. Each alert is now sharded by county code rather than broadcast globally, so check that the shard map migration runs before the dispatcher restarts. Verify the dry-run output shows zero orphaned counties. Once you approve, the build must be signed for the alert pipeline to accept it, using the key that follows.

deploy key for kajof-fajop: bky6_gDHw9Q

Session handling in Pagecairn ties role-based access to short-lived session claims. Roles are resolved at login and cached for fifteen minutes; any role change by an administrator forces re-evaluation on the next request. Before cutting a release, verify the claim-refresh job completed cleanly on staging. To query the staging session audit endpoint, use the bearer token below.

session JWT of yawep-yawep = eyJhbGciOiJIUzI1NiIsInR5cCI6IkpXVCJ9.eyJzdWIiOiI3pWF3_In0.aXYsHiog